    Please, before you buy, check out the Sharon Schamber site on youtube
    http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=GdJ3_2-0n3o
    and see if you might consider the velcro...i have the zippers, and in many ways they are nice but i have been trying to talk myself into buying the velcro needed to replace this system for that one.... it looks so quick... as is the rail system... if i had it to do over, i would probably buy one of the other 2 newer systems.. http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=gOpPP...4&feature=plcp
    the zippers are quick, if they are mounted perfectly... but it took time to get this done... both of the other two systems are so quick to put on that you can re-do in minutes if it's not perfect..
